We did our first Nasty Cookie review when the New York-inspired gourmet cookie brand opened as an online-only retail store in 2018. The local cookie mogul has since expanded to three physical stores across the island, including Funan, and Westgate.
Nasty Cookie specialises in chunky, New York-inspired cookies that are handcrafted and freshly baked for their signature crispy and chewy textures. Born and bred in Singapore, the bakery uses only premium dark couverture chocolate for an ooey, gooey inside and uber-luxurious taste.
